#448 — The Philosophy of Good and Evil
<p>Sam Harris speaks with David Edmonds about moral philosophy and effective altruism. They discuss Edmonds's book <a href= "https://amzn.to/48HrCSQ" target="_blank" rel="noopener"><em>Death in a Shallow Pond</em></a>, Peter Singer's famous drowning child thought experiment, arguments for and against thought experiments, "trolleyology," consequentialism, the origins of the Effective Altruism movement, the controversial strategy of "earning to give," Derek Parfit's influence on contemporary ethics, the backlash against effective altruists, Angus Deaton's critique of the efficacy of foreign aid, and other topics.</p> <p>If the Making …
